Support US Market Access decision-making by applying advanced analytics to payer, PBM, formulary, policy, and claims datasets.
Develop and deliver timely, high-quality analytic reports and insights for Market Access, Pricing, and Launch Planning teams using AI/ML methods.
Manage data infrastructure, dashboards, and governance to enable scalable, reliable analytics and automate reporting processes.
1 to 3 years professional experience in US Market Access and/or Pricing Analytics.
BA/BS required; advanced degree preferred in life/physical sciences, applied sciences, or engineering.
Proficiency in Python, SQL, and experience with large healthcare datasets (claims, formulary, IQVIA/SHS).
Experience working with US Market Access, reimbursement, regulatory, and compliance domains.
Experienced in applying machine learning, AI/ML, NLP, and predictive analytics to healthcare market access challenges.
Ability to translate complex secondary data and policy insights into actionable recommendations for senior stakeholders.
Skilled in integrating new AI tools (Claude, Databricks, Copilot) in collaborative analytics environments to enhance insight generation.
